高耐化学性覆盖膜的制备与应用研究

Study on preparation and properties of chemical resistance coating coverlay

摘要 制备一种环氧涂层并在PI表面涂布,固化后得到涂层PI膜。在涂层PI膜的另一面涂布一层改性环氧胶粘剂,并与离型纸覆合,即得到耐化性涂层覆盖膜。对比测试耐化性涂层覆盖膜和普通覆盖膜的耐碱性、耐除胶渣性能及其他各项基本性能。结果显示,涂层可有效保护PI膜不被碱液及除胶渣药水咬噬;涂层覆盖膜与普通覆盖膜在柔软性、耐热老化性能、耐热性、力学性能、耐折性及激光加工性方面基本相当。 A epoxy coating was prepared and coated on polyimide film and then cured to prepare coating polyimide film.A modified epoxy adhesive was coated on the other side of coating polyimide film and covered with release paper to prepare a chemical resistance coating coverlay.A comparison test was taken between normal coverlay and chemical resistance coating coverlay.The results showed that the chemical resistance coating could protect polyimide film from being corroded by alkali liquor and desmear potion.Chemical resistance coating coverlay and normal coverlay were roughly equivalent in terms of flexibility,heat aging resistance,heat resistance,mechanical properties,folding resistance and laser processability.
